System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种移动充电车的避障方法、电子设备及存储介质技术_技高网

一种移动充电车的避障方法、电子设备及存储介质技术

技术编号:41342000 阅读:5 留言:0更新日期:2024-05-20 09:59
本发明专利技术提供了一种移动充电车的避障方法、电子设备及存储介质,涉及移动充电车避障技术领域,所述方法包括:获取移动充电车的车头与目标障碍物的距离;获取所述移动充电车纵向的长度L<subgt;1</subgt;;根据L<subgt;1</subgt;,确定位于初始直线路径上的起始点MA和位于初始直线路径上的终止点MB;将MA和MB之间的初始直线路径确定为平移直线路径,并将平移直线路径平移至目标障碍物的目标侧之外;生成避障路径;控制所述移动充电车沿着所述避障路径行驶且保持车头朝向不变;本发明专利技术能够使得移动充电车避障过程中,尾部不会发生摆动,进而能够在较为狭小的空间内实现避障。

【技术实现步骤摘要】

本专利技术涉及移动充电车避障,特别是涉及一种移动充电车的避障方法、电子设备及存储介质


技术介绍

1、随着新能源行业的快速发展,对充电枪的需求量越来越大,然而充电枪的增设速度远低于新能源车的增加速度,从而导致固定充电枪的难以满足新能源车的充电需求;因此,在一些固定的场合,设置了移动充电车,移动充电车能够根据预先规划的行驶路径行驶至需要充电的车辆旁;由于移动充电车的行驶路径是预先规划的,在行驶过程中,预先规划的路径上可能会存在目标障碍物,常规的避障方式是在目标障碍物周侧重新生成圆弧形的避障路径,然后控制移动充电车沿着避障路径行驶;但是,通过该方式避障时,移动充电车的车头朝向是会一直变化的,导致移动充电车的尾部产生较大的位移,在空间狭小的区域难以实现避障。


技术实现思路

1、针对上述技术问题,本专利技术采用的技术方案为:

2、根据本申请的第一方面,提供了一种移动充电车的避障方法,所述方法包括以下步骤:

3、s100,获取移动充电车的车头与目标障碍物的距离lq;其中,所述目标障碍物为位于所述移动充电车的车头前方以及预设的初始直线路径上的障碍物。

4、s200,若lq≤qw且hz≤h’,则获取所述移动充电车纵向的长度l1;其中,qw为预设的第一距离阈值;hz为目标障碍物的高度,h’为预设的目标障碍物高度阈值。

5、s300,根据l1,确定位于初始直线路径上的起始点ma和位于初始直线路径上的终止点mb;其中,ma和mb分别位于目标障碍物纵向的两侧,ma位于目标障碍物和移动充电车之间。

6、s400,将ma和mb之间的初始直线路径确定为平移直线路径,并将平移直线路径平移至目标障碍物的目标侧之外;其中,目标障碍物的目标侧为目标障碍物横向的一侧;平移后的ma和mb之间的初始直线路径与所述目标侧的最小距离db=l2/2+δl;其中,l2为移动充电车的横向宽度,δl为预设的第二距离阈值。

7、s500,将ma与ma’连接以及mb与mb’连接,生成避障路径;其中,ma’为平移直线路径上与ma对应的连接点,mb’为平移直线路径上与mb对应的连接点。

8、s600,控制所述移动充电车沿着所述避障路径行驶且保持车头朝向不变。

9、根据本申请的另一方面,还提供了一种非瞬时性计算机可读存储介质,存储介质中存储有至少一条指令或至少一段程序,至少一条指令或至少一段程序由处理器加载并执行以实现上述移动充电车的避障方法。

10、根据本申请的另一方面,还提供了一种电子设备,包括处理器和上述非瞬时性计算机可读存储介质。

11、本专利技术至少具有以下有益效果:

12、本专利技术的移动充电车的避障方法,当移动充电车的车头与目标障碍物的距离小于等于预设的第一距离阈值时,根据移动充电车纵向的长度,确定位于初始直线路径上的起始点ma和位于初始直线路径上的终止点mb,将ma和mb之间的初始直线路径确定为平移直线路径,并将平移直线路径平移至目标障碍物的目标侧之外,使得平移后的ma和mb之间的初始直线路径与所述目标侧的最小距离db=l2/2+δl,使得移动充电车沿着平移直线路径行驶时,不会与目标障碍物发生碰撞;进而根据平移直线路径生成避障路径,控制移动充电车沿着所述避障路径行驶且保持车头朝向不变,以达到避障的目的;由于移动充电车在沿着避障路径行驶时,车头朝向始终固定不变,使得移动充电车的尾部不会发生摆动,进而能够在较为狭小的空间内实现避障。

13、进一步的,本专利技术的方法中是将初始直线路径的一部分平移至目标障碍物的目标侧,而不是重新根据环境信息再次生成部分避障路径;因此,通过本专利技术的方法重新规划的避障路径所消耗的算力较小,移动充电车避障的效率较高。

本文档来自技高网...

【技术保护点】

1.一种移动充电车的避障方法,其特征在于,所述方法包括以下步骤:

2.根据权利要求1所述的移动充电车的避障方法,其特征在于,MA与目标障碍物之间的距离大于等于L1/2,MB与目标障碍物之间的距离大于等于L1。

3.根据权利要求2所述的移动充电车的避障方法,其特征在于,MA与目标障碍物之间的距离等于L1/2;QW通过以下步骤确定:

4.根据权利要求3所述的移动充电车的避障方法,其特征在于,QW满足以下关系:QW=(R1+R2)/cosα-R2-L1/2;MA’和MB’的位置通过以下步骤确定:

5.根据权利要求1所述的移动充电车的避障方法,其特征在于,目标障碍物的目标侧通过以下步骤确定:

6.根据权利要求1所述的移动充电车的避障方法,其特征在于,在步骤S100之后,所述方法包括以下步骤:

7.根据权利要求6所述的移动充电车的避障方法,其特征在于,预设角度的范围为30°-60°。

8.根据权利要求6所述的移动充电车的避障方法,其特征在于,所述预设距离等于L1。

9.一种非瞬时性计算机可读存储介质,所述存储介质中存储有至少一条指令或至少一段程序,其特征在于,所述至少一条指令或所述至少一段程序由处理器加载并执行以实现如权利要求1-8中任意一项所述的移动充电车的避障方法。

10.一种电子设备,其特征在于,包括处理器和权利要求9中所述的非瞬时性计算机可读存储介质。

...

【技术特征摘要】

1.一种移动充电车的避障方法,其特征在于,所述方法包括以下步骤:

2.根据权利要求1所述的移动充电车的避障方法,其特征在于,ma与目标障碍物之间的距离大于等于l1/2,mb与目标障碍物之间的距离大于等于l1。

3.根据权利要求2所述的移动充电车的避障方法,其特征在于,ma与目标障碍物之间的距离等于l1/2;qw通过以下步骤确定:

4.根据权利要求3所述的移动充电车的避障方法,其特征在于,qw满足以下关系:qw=(r1+r2)/cosα-r2-l1/2;ma’和mb’的位置通过以下步骤确定:

5.根据权利要求1所述的移动充电车的避障方法,其特征在于,目标障碍物的目标侧通过以下步骤确定:...

【专利技术属性】
技术研发人员:吴经纬邓晓光梁元波黄泽君
申请(专利权)人:国广顺能上海能源科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1